right, lowrey, i've seen several of these blatant ripoffs from KK, without finding a reasonable account for it. So it has raised the following dilemma to me: usually, ripoffs are bad but cheap copies of the original, cf Blackscissors leathers that cost 1/10 of the RO jacket they imitate. On an other level, there are designers that don't seem to have trust in their own ideas, and prefer to take 'inspiration' from the work of others (some beloved SZ designers fall into this category i'm afraid, a well-known 'handmade' shoemaker of course, but others as well). But Kumagai has his own designs, it seems... (i don't really know his work to be honest) so WTF ?
and, last but not least: what if a ripoff was better than the original? Imagine that the attachment version of the Intarsia jacket was made of a far better leather than the RO version, with a better cut, better stitchings, and so on...? which one would be the best to get?pix
